📝 Color Information for #BD7FBB

The hexadecimal color code #BD7FBB represents a light shade in the purple family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 189 red, 127 green, and 187 blue, which translates to approximately 74% red, 50% green, and 73% blue. This makes it a slightly desatur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#BD7FBB has a hue of 302 degrees, a saturation level of 32%, and a lightness value of 62%. The hue angle of 302° places this color firmly in the purple sp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 302°, saturation of 33%, and brightness/value of 74%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#BD7FBB would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 33% magenta, 1% yellow, and 26% black. The closest web-safe color is #CC66CC,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#BD7FBB with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 122°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 12419003,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#BD7FBB? +

The approximate CMYK value of #BD7FBB is C:0% M:33% Y:1% K:26%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
